A DAY IN THE LIFE

On any given day, you are responsible for reviewing your individual emails as well as those received in the shared inbox. You will prioritize your work weekly with minimal help from your leader(s) and personally reevaluate daily in case of new initiatives – you will be a part of an ever-evolving environment with fluctuating daily goals. You will assist with questions from stakeholders around the Resort about how products were configured and/or user setup and ultimately be a subject matter expert. This could mean in-person meetings or virtual meetings and you must be comfortable with both.
You will configure admission products and work independently on your assigned products. You are often also a representative of the Ticket Administration team in meetings with senior leaders and must provide succinct responses to balance being an advocate for our team’s needs and point of view while being flexible and collaborative. You will complete the work needed to move projects forward in the technology space around ticket products, reservations, and the overall Guest Experience. Most of your products and their configurations as well as the project work are confidential. Time each day is spent supporting fellow Financial Analysts and mentoring Staff Analysts through discussion as each Cast Member on the team is expected to be a resource for each other in product launches, project work, and career growth.

ABOUT THE ROLE & TEAM

“Let’s make some magic!” If your three wishes are to enjoy your job, make wishes come true, and merge that with technical skills, Disneyland Resort Ticket Administration may be the place for you. In this position, you will be a system administrator for Galaxy - the software used for managing ticket products.

WHAT YOU WILL DO

You will lead project and system enhancement work including design, prioritization, and user acceptance testing. You will review data, analyze trends, and provide monthly reporting and use that information to identify options to reduce or eliminate future issues or control gaps. You will implement new projects through partnership with leaders, peers, and Resort partners. When recommending changes, you will confer with your leader and proceed with development upon approval from your leader. On this team, we will empower you to make decisions relative to everyday operations and workload, including resolution of issues.

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Support project timelines for all ticketing system enhancements and implementations; work with leadership and Technology to ensure deliverables are met; work with Operations to ensure successful system rollouts
  • Coordinate capture and resolution of project requirements and punch lists
  • Maintain confidentiality and support Resort-wide and interdepartmental projects by managing, designing, or contributing to enhancements
  • Contribute to training materials and methods of procedure
  • Ensure accurate setup and testing of ticket products and systems
  • Contribute to the development of written operating guidelines and procedures for all processes
  • Ensure compliance with company guidelines and requirements as well as internal controls by implementing policies, procedures, and security standards
  • Lead scheduled compliance audits to ensure adequacy of controls (including Sarbanes-Oxley)
  • Manage relationships with partners (Technology, Financial Systems, Revenue Management, Pricing, Sales, Marketing, Operations) to provide expertise on ticket product, procedural guidance, and to ensure compliance with ticket and system policies
  • Participate in resolution of ticketing system and product setup related issues
  • Provide procedural education to end-users of the ticketing system including documenting processes
  • Serve as support liaison with domestic Ticket Administration partners
  • Function as a point of contact with Technology on any ticketing system that could potentially affect sales through Main Entrance Operations, Digital Technologies, mitigating issues that could negatively affect the Guest experience
  • Manage reports for product importing, exporting, and auditing
  • Identify areas of opportunity to improve efficiency for the department while understanding downstream impacts
  • Consolidate information to propose change while clearly stating risks and opportunities
  • Handle rush requests for ticket programming and constant interaction with numerous departments
  • Work in a hybrid-flex work model where four previously identified days a week will be at the on-site office in Team Disney Anaheim and the option to work from home the other day
